The name can come from a number of sources. It can be added at the origination, sometimes by the customer (less likely), or by the originating provider. A lookup can be done from a database, or the name may have been added in the originating providers switch, against the customers number. A name lookup can be done by the terminating provider, usually if no name is attached to the call. Most providers charge for this, if a database is queried, as it is usually not owned by the provider. In some cases, the name may simply show as a city, state, province, or country, if there is no user listing found.
